The breakaway success of the IDOLM@STER series had suggested to many that the demographics of the previous generation had finally found a new home, and the console began to be hailed as the heir to ADV throne. However, as ADV publishers soon found out, IM@S fans and the like were more discerning about their tastes than those of previous generations. If you weren't a product up their alley, you were set for failure. Now admist declining hardware sales and a limited userbase, publishers struggle with the decision of staying on a console that offers cheap and easy development, but with a battle against an unknown demographic.

5pb - The vanguard of the 360 faction, with CEO Shikura Chiyomaru leveraging comments such as 'Not many people actually use the PS3 as a gaming console' and 'The Xbox 360 has a higher software attach rate, that is why we prefer it.' 5pb is known as the creators of CHAOS;HEAD, Steins;Gate, and as the current developers of the Memories Off franchise.

Nitroplus - A highly popular PC game studio, best known for works such as Saya no Uta, Demonbane, and Phantom. They announced their intent to develop for the 360 after the experienced they gained from the CHAOS;HEAD port collaboration with 5pb.

PROTOTYPE - A company that mainly ports VisualArts games to consoles. They initially began development on the 360, but after a string of unsuccessful releases caused by poor marketing and poor release timing (similar to a certain other company...) they're now trying their luck with the PS3.

Cyberfront - A PC and console game developer/localizer, they were the ones who bought up KID's library once they went down under. They've released numerous localized western titles for the 360 such as Arcana Gothic 4 and nail'd. But after the lack of success of the Strike Witches shmup and the subsequent announcement of PS3 titles such as the enhanced Mamoru-kun port, it seemed as if their days with exclusive 360-developed titles were done... until recently with the sudden announcement of new enhanced ADV ports and a new entry in the infinity series, all exclusively for the 360.

Its predecessor was the undisputed leader of the previous generation, yet it has not experienced quite the same success. With hardware sales that quadruples its competitor, strong brand association, and little to no competitors on the ADV front, it would seem to be the perfect situation for any ADV publisher to take control of and be successful with, and yet...

AQUAPLUS - The consumer branch of Leaf, they are the premier ADV developer for the PS3. Sony's initial financial incentives (read: moneyhats) garnered their support in the form of 2 entries into the ADV+RPG hybrid franchise, Tears to Tiara. This was followed by their masterpiece ADV, White Album. They are the only developer to have been successful with ADVs on the PS3

Maid Meets Cat - A brand new startup company with character designs by Sasaki Mutsumi (Happy Lesson, Chaos;Head, Futakoi). They had just barely finished the release of their first title, L@ve once for the PSP... when suddenly a PS3 port was announced. It will be the second HD ADV to date that will feature Motion Portrait technology.

MOONSTONE - Primarily a PC bishoujo game company. One of their games, Gift, was released for download in English on the iTunes App Store last year. They're porting their game, Marginal Skip as a BD-J-PG (think interactive movie style) that can play and save to the PS3's HDD.

So the average ADV sells 5,000 copies? ...
In the old days, console ADVs could comfortably sell around 60K on average. Nowadays, your average PC port nets 10~12K in sales. If you're doing ~25K you're pretty good, even higher and it's time to break out the champagne...
